Personal Injury Law Essentials

Personal injury law encompasses a wide spectrum of cases where individuals seek compensation for injuries caused by negligence or wrongful acts. Key aspects include:

  • Negligence: Demonstrating that another party’s carelessness caused your injury.
  • Duty of Care: Establishing that the other party had a responsibility to ensure your safety.
  • Damages: Calculating the costs of medical bills, lost wages, and other associated losses.
  • Litigation Process: Understanding the steps involved in pursuing a claim, including filing deadlines and court proceedings.

Personal injury cases often require comprehensive documentation and evidence, making skilled legal representation essential.

Understanding Legal Fees and Costs

The legal process comes with various costs that you should be aware of:

  • Hourly Rates: Many lawyers charge based on the time spent on your case.
  • Retainers: A sum paid upfront to secure services, typically covering future billable hours.
  • Contingency Fees: A percentage of the settlement or award, applicable in certain cases like personal injury.
  • Flat Fees: A pre-agreed amount for specific services (e.g., drafting a will).

Understanding the various fee structures can assist in budgeting for legal services and planning accordingly.

Preparing for Your Initial Consultation

Your initial consultation sets the stage for your legal journey. Adequately preparing can enhance this meeting’s effectiveness. Consider:

  • Gathering relevant documents related to your case.
  • Creating a list of questions to ask regarding their experience and your situation.
  • Outlining your goals and expectations clearly.
  • Being honest about your situation, including any potential challenges.

A well-prepared consultation leads to a better understanding and effective planning.
